BJJ competitions started emerging in Brazil in the mid-20th century. Practitioners developed a distinctive style emphasizing control on the ground with submissions and positional transitions.
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u developed under the premise that most real fights inevitably go to the ground. The art’s approach strongly emphasizes grappling tactics rather than striking.
Absolutely.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u techniques effectively leverage body mechanics so that proper technique allows smaller and less athletic people to control and submit bigger, stronger opponents. Anyone can benefit from BJJ with the right mindset to learn.
